Government Selects Naver as Operator for Cybersecurity-Specialized AI Model Development Project (Update)
Naver Cloud to Receive 256 B200 GPUs in Total
The Ministry of Science and ICT announced on September 3 that, after a presentation evaluation of the two applicants (SK Telecom and Naver Cloud) participating in the bidding for the "AI Foundation Model Development Specialized for Cybersecurity" project, the Naver Cloud consortium has been selected as the final project operator.
During the presentation evaluation, a committee composed of external experts in the fields of artificial intelligence and cybersecurity comprehensively assessed the technical capabilities, development experience, strategies and technologies, feasibility and excellence of the objectives, as well as the marketability and potential ripple effects, based on the business plans and presentations submitted by each consortium.
Naver Cloud was recognized for its outstanding technical expertise and development experience, its large-scale industry-academia-research consortium, and its superior development strategy and objectives, including the composition of multiple agents and harnesses.
Starting this month, Naver Cloud will receive support for a total of 256 B200 graphic processing units (GPUs) for a period of 10 months. After 5 months, an interim evaluation will determine whether support for the remaining 5 months will continue.

The Ministry of Science and ICT plans to sign an agreement with the selected company within this month and begin developing the cybersecurity-specialized foundation model through GPU support. The ministry will also immediately form a working consultative body with Naver Cloud to strive for rapid achievement of outcomes.
